Adding what was cut off. Always get the IDs of anyone you speak with via call.
Send a Qualified Written Request (certified mail) to their Central Customer Service Department. Cc James Daras - CEO and President. Robert Lux - Executive VP. Include all documented proof- cancelled checks, letter from bank, printed docs of monies paid, et al. They’re legally obligated to answer. 425 Phillips Boulevard, Ewing, NJ 08628 ATTENTION: QUALIFIED WRITTEN REQUEST

We are currently under contract to buy a house from a seller whose loan is held by CENLAR. Our escrow closing date has been delayed week after week due to CENLAR's unresponsiveness. First they were "unable to verify" the status of the seller's loan. The seller, our lender, and our mutual title officer have spent hours every day for the past 5 weeks trying to get this resolved. Most recently, after several hours on the phone, a supervisor at CENLAR verbally confirmed to our lender that the lien has been released and the payoff statement was faxed to the title company, but it never arrived and then CENLAR "couldn't find" the original form that was supposedly sent. It's been over a week now since they claim to have faxed the payoff statement and we still are unable to close.
Based on the information that we have received from our realtor, lender, and title officer, it appears that CENLAR is either deliberately sabotaging the sale of this house or their employees are so incompetent that it borders on criminal negligence. They are costing us and their customer (the seller in this transaction) hundreds, if not thousands, of dollars in additional taxes, interest, and fees. This is our first home-buying experience and our nerves are so frayed. We are begging our lender, please don't ever sell our mortgage to CENLAR!!!
